Output f806deebec74eb65afbc4d82b4b02d8f5efaaf62eebcfeff8dd3136caf6162fe:597

value
2090
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 51dca6bb062d5063ce52216a988877dd31663777ad73e7e452cb5ada18659fa9
address
bc1p28w2dwcx94gx8njjy94f3zrhm5ckvdmh44e70ezjeddd5xr9n75s9qx7ya
transaction
f806deebec74eb65afbc4d82b4b02d8f5efaaf62eebcfeff8dd3136caf6162fe
confirmations
107751
spent
true